Firestone Transforce HT is the only LOAD RANGE E tire in current production in 8.75R16.5 size.

Load range D tires are CLOSE to their max load limit on THE FRONT AXLE of a GMC at or above max GVW. If you have two LRE tires that you can put on the front (and a LRE spare), LRD tires will work on the rears. They will work on the front if you don't mind being close to max weight capacity.

You will find more selection in LRD tires of that size.
